ATLAS Offline Software
Run2.py
Go to the documentation of this file.
1 # Copyright (C) 2002-2024 CERN for the benefit of the ATLAS collaboration
2 from Campaigns.Utils import Campaign
3 
4 
5 def Run2_2015_HeavyIons(flags):
6  """flags for MC to match 2015 Heavy Ion data"""
7  flags.Input.MCCampaign = Campaign.MC23a # FIXME
8 
9  flags.Beam.NumberOfCollisions = 0.
10  flags.Input.ConditionsRunNumber = 295000
11  flags.Input.OverrideRunNumber = True
12  flags.Input.RunAndLumiOverrideList = None # Doesn't work??
13  from LArConfiguration.LArConfigRun2 import LArConfigRun2NoPileUp
15  flags.Digitization.HighGainEMECIW = True
16 
17  flags.Digitization.PU.NumberOfCavern = 1
18  flags.Digitization.PU.NumberOfLowPtMinBias = 0.0
19  flags.Digitization.PU.NumberOfHighPtMinBias = 0.0
20  #flags.Digitization.PU.CustomProfile={"run":295000, "startmu":0.0, "endmu":0.0, "stepmu":1.0, "startlb":1, "timestamp": 1475000000}
21  flags.Digitization.PU.InitialBunchCrossing = 0
22  flags.Digitization.PU.FinalBunchCrossing = 0
23  flags.Digitization.PU.BunchStructureConfig = 'RunDependentSimData.BunchStructure_2015_HeavyIons'
24  flags.Sim.TRTRangeCut=0.05
python.Run2.Run2_2015_HeavyIons
def Run2_2015_HeavyIons(flags)
Definition: Run2.py:5
python.LArConfigRun2.LArConfigRun2NoPileUp
def LArConfigRun2NoPileUp(flags)
Definition: LArConfigRun2.py:13